Recipe: Mint Chicken (Using Guts To Goals Spearmint Tea)

Ingredients

  • 4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Contents of 5–10 Guts To Goals Spearmint Tea teabags (adjust according to preference)
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 cup chicken broth (or 1 broth cube dissolved in 1/2 cup water)
  • Juice of ½ lemon (optional)

Directions

  1. Empty the contents of 5–10 Guts To Goals Spearmint Tea teabags and pour the dried spearmint into a small bowl.
  2. Season the chicken with salt and pepper.
  3. Melt the butter in a skillet over medium heat.
  4. Add the garlic and cook for about 30 seconds until fragrant.
  5. Stir in the dried spearmint from the teabags and cook briefly (about 15–30 seconds) to release its aroma.
  6. Add the chicken and cook for 5–7 minutes per side, or until fully cooked.
  7. Pour in the chicken broth (and lemon juice if using) and simmer for 2–3 minutes.
  8. Spoon the sauce over the chicken and serve warm.

Tip

One Guts To Goals Spearmint Tea teabag contains approximately 1 gram of dried spearmint. Depending on how mint-forward you’d like the dish to be, 5–10 teabags (5–10 grams) work well for a family-sized recipe.
